Title: sshd keeps stopping
Post by DAvidH on Feb 28th, 2008 at 9:20pm
I've got a 3100 that I tried to upgrade to 7.1.1 and it seems I've somehow corrupted the packages--I won't go into details so I can save a little face :-). I can still log in to the # prompt, so I want to use sshd and scp to get the 7.1.1 packages on the modem, but when I start sshd it only runs for 15-20 seconds before stopping. A look at /var/log/messages shows 'auth.info sshd[2968]: Received signal 15; terminating.'

Any ideas?

Title: Re: sshd keeps stopping
Post by TDMAMike on Feb 29th, 2008 at 2:47am
Interesting...

When you are on the linux prompt (#) does the modem reboot (ever)?  

What is falcon telling you?  Check its status by typing:

service idirect_falcon status

Running or stopped?

Title: Re: sshd keeps stopping
Post by DAvidH on Feb 29th, 2008 at 5:10am
The modem does not reboot. I was able to load my correct options file via the hyperterm session, and copy/pasting it into falcon.opt. When I did that, it would reboot on its own. So I went back to the original that I had renamed, and it stopped doing that.

Falcon tells me it's running, and so is falcon_monitor.

The real trouble is that when I telnet 0, I see '[ErrorStack] admin@telnet:127.0.0.0;1024' and then the normal prompt. If I type in 'help' I see all of six commands listed. The command 'laninfo' is not one of them, and when I type that command I get 'unkown command'. That's just and example; same thing with other commands.

Title: Re: sshd keeps stopping
Post by TDMAMike on Feb 29th, 2008 at 11:43am
So falcon is running..and sshd stops after falcon is running. Hmmm.  Interesting.

Do you have IP connectivity to this box (interfaces are functional?) I am sure you do if falcon is running.  However, it does sound as if something is corrupt in falcon process.  Especially if the telnet to localhost is not yielding the normal results (laninfo, etc).  

When you upgraded this 3100 to 7.1.1, you loaded the cumulative update on it first, correct? Followed by the image and opt?  Did you do all of this on console or by GUI?  

Have you tried stopping facon and running sshd?  Not sure if it will help but worth a try.  

Title: Re: sshd keeps stopping
Post by DAvidH on Mar 3rd, 2008 at 12:37pm
I figured this out, and then forgot to come back here and post the results. I had to stop the idirect_falcon service in order to keep sshd running. Mike, your guess was correct.

So once I had sshd running with no problems, I then SCP'd over the 7.1.1 cumulative and remote packages, as well as my option file. Then I continued via the console, and followed the directions in the iDirect Technical Note for Recovering iNFINITI Remotes. In Section 5 I repeated Step 6, doing it once for the Cumulative package, and then again for the Remote package.

Everything worked great after that. I can't say I'm happy this happened, but I'm glad I was able to learn a lot more about iDirect modems.
